Trier une liste qui en appelle une autre

Bonjour.

J'ai un tableau initial obtenu par des formules. Il est composé de deux colonnes. La deuxième colonne est constituée de nombres.

Sans toucher à ce tableau, je souhaiterais en créer un deuxième qui reprend les éléments du premier avec cependant, la condition que chaque nombre de la seconde colonne est supérieur à 2.

Donc, en admettant que mon premier tableau est sur les colonnes A et B, je construis le deuxième tq :

=SI(B1>2;A1;0) dans la première colonne

=SI(B1>2;B1;0) dans la seconde

Mais après je ne peux pas trier par ordre décroissant par rapport à la seconde colonne.

Comment faire ? Merci.

Bonjour,

Si je comprends bien ta problématique, tu ne souhaites pas trier les 0 car ils ne représentent pas une valeur mais plutôt une absence de donnée d'intérêt ? Dans ce cas, dans tes formules "SI", affecte autre chose que 0, par exemple:

=SI(B1>2;A1;"")

=SI(B1>2;B1;"")

Ou :

=SI(B1>2;A1;NA())

=SI(B1>2;B1;NA())

Pas vraiment. Voilà un exemple.

J'ai crée ce que je voulais dans les colonnes E et F. J'essaye de trier par rapport aux valeurs de la colonne F. Donc j'utilise :

DONNÉES -> Trier et Filtrer -> Z-A

Mais ça ne fonctionne pas. Comment faire ?

Merci.

9excelforum.xlsx (8.60 Ko)

Je te renvoie ton fichier, je n'ai fait que 2 choses :

  • -> Passer le second tableau dans un autre onglet
  • -> Ajouter des en-têtes

Chez moi le tri fonctionne, mais je te déconseille quand même de faire un tri sur des colonnes contenant des formules...

7excelforum.xlsx (11.20 Ko)

Ca ne fonctionne pas chez moi.

J'ai essayé de le faire avec mes données.

Si quelqu'un a une autre solution.

Comment fais tu ton tri ? Moi ça fonctionne de cette manière :

illu1

Je le fais exactement de cette manière, mais rien ne bouge.

Alors là je sèche...

Bonjour le forum,

I3 : =GRANDE.VALEUR($F$3:$F$5;LIGNE()-2)

tri

Bonjour !

Tu peux m'expliquer grossièrement les formules s'il te plait ?

Et il manque Aix qui devrait être trié dans le second tableau.

Re,

Résultats attendus ?

tri v2

Ouais, nickel !

Merci beaucoup.

Finalement, je te relance car je bloque sur quelque chose.

Ici, j'applique les formules que tu m'as donné. Et j'obtiens le tableau le plus à droite.

Cependant, je devrais obtenir Saint-Etienne à la place d'un des deux "Aix". Ca vient du fait que Saint Etienne et Aix ont la même valeur : 28.9

Comment régler ceci ? Merci !

bonjour

une contribution avec qques explications

7kwns24.xlsx (10.47 Ko)

cordialement

Bonjour.

Je ne comprends pas. J'ai essayé de remplacer bêtement vos A,B,C par mes colonnes dans mon fichier mais rien à faire, ça fonctionne pas.

J'essaye de comprendre votre formule mais ça signifie quoi le B$1:B$5 > 2 ?

Merci.

Re,

quelqu'un pourrait m'aider à résoudre mon problème sur ce fichier ci-joint ?

Je dois mettre dans la colonnes, les villes associées au nombre de la colonne B, que l'on retrouve dans la colonne D.

Merci.

3help.xlsx (8.30 Ko)

re

avant daller plus loin

ma réponse marchait ou pas ? dans l'exemple

Re,

Voir le fichier joint.

6classement.xlsm (12.30 Ko)

Oui c'était nickel !

La seule différence est que mon tableau de départ contient des lignes avec des 0 (dans les deux colonnes), mais sinon oui.

Re,

Voir le fichier joint.

ça fonctionne nickel, merci beaucoup !

Rechercher des sujets similaires à "trier liste qui appelle"